Meanwhile, year-to-date through September, U.S. brewers have shipped more than 126.5 million barrels of beer, a decline of 0.9% (or more than 1.1 million barrels), according to domestic tax paid estimates from the Alcohol and Tobacco Tax and Trade Bureau (TTB) shared by the Beer Institute.

Philadelphia-headquartered, on-demand delivery platform goPuff today announced a $350 million deal to acquire off-premise beverage alcohol retailer BevMo. The transaction is expected to close within the next 30 days, pending “customary closing conditions.” Bloomberg first reported talks of a deal earlier today.

Craft beer lovers in Virginia will once again be able to buy beer from Bell’s Brewery. The Michigan craft brewery announced Wednesday that it will once again ship beer to the state, starting in about two weeks, after a nearly 21 month absence.

New Orleanians will soon find a familiar word adorning the packaging of a newly renamed local beer brand. The 113-year-old Dixie Beer will change its name to Faubourg Brewing Company in early 2021. Faubourg, which means “suburb” in French, is synonymous with “neighborhood” in New Orleans.
